The AI industry may be heading toward another major shift. Reports suggest that OpenAI could introduce advertising inside ChatGPT, potentially opening a completely new digital marketing channel for brands.

Early advertisers might need a minimum spend of around $200,000, making it a premium entry point for companies looking to reach millions of highly engaged AI users. If this happens, it will mark a significant evolution in how advertising works in the digital age.

First came search engine ads, then social media marketing, and now AI-powered conversational advertising could be the next frontier. Instead of traditional banner ads, brands may be able to interact with users through context-aware recommendations and personalized conversations.

For businesses, this could mean smarter targeting, real-time engagement, and more personalized outreach. For users, it signals a new era where AI assistants and digital advertising intersect in ways we’ve never seen before.

The future of marketing may not just be on websites or social media it could happen inside AI conversations.

The future of energy might not be on Earth it could be in space.

Shimizu Corporation has unveiled an ambitious concept called the “Luna Ring Solar Array” a massive solar power system designed to orbit the Moon along its equator. The idea is to build a continuous belt of solar panels capable of capturing near-uninterrupted sunlight and generating stable, large-scale renewable energy.

Unlike Earth, the Moon experiences long daylight periods, making it an ideal location for consistent solar power generation. The system would convert sunlight into electricity and then wirelessly transmit that energy back to Earth using advanced power-beaming technology.

If successfully developed, this project could provide a virtually limitless clean energy source, reduce global dependence on fossil fuels, cut carbon emissions, and completely transform the world’s energy infrastructure.

This isn’t just a power project it could mark the beginning of a new era in space-based renewable energy.

he tech world has taken another revolutionary leap as Xiaomi officially unveils its AI-powered “dark factory” in China. It’s called a dark factory because the facility operates 24/7 without human workers and without lights. Artificial intelligence, advanced robotics, and smart sensors manage the entire production process autonomously.

From device assembly to quality control, defect detection, and logistics management, everything is handled with unmatched speed and precision. The result is faster production, greater consistency, and minimal human error.

This breakthrough represents a major shift in the manufacturing industry, where factories are evolving into intelligent ecosystems capable of making real-time decisions. As AI continues to reshape global industries, smart factories like this are setting new benchmarks for productivity and scalability.

The future isn’t just automation — it’s intelligent automation.

An unusual case from Southeast China has revealed the hidden value inside electronic waste, where a man reportedly extracted 191 grams of gold from discarded SIM cards. This story highlights the growing potential of urban mining recovering precious metals from old electronics like phones, circuit boards, and SIMs which could become a more sustainable alternative to traditional mining.

However, the process also raises serious environmental and safety concerns due to the hazardous chemicals involved. Without proper technology and safety standards, toxic fumes and chemical waste can cause long-term damage to both humans and the environment.

As digital consumption continues to rise globally, responsible e-waste management and sustainable recycling practices are no longer optional they are essential for the future.

Pakistan’s textile industry is not just an economic pillar it is a living testament to centuries of tradition, skill, and hard work. Rooted in the country’s fertile lands, cotton cultivation has been a way of life for generations, shaping rural communities and sustaining livelihoods. In the early days, before the advent of AI, automation, and modern machinery, every stage of textile production from picking cotton to spinning yarn and weaving fabric was carried out manually.

Artisans relied on experience, precision, and patience, passing their knowledge from one generation to the next. Every thread carried the mark of human touch; every fabric told a story of dedication and craft. The textile mills and handlooms that dotted the landscape were more than production centers; they were hubs of culture, innovation, and resilience.

This legacy laid the foundation for Pakistan’s rise as one of the world’s leading cotton-producing nations. It is a story of a time when human hands shaped the nation’s most iconic industry—a chapter in history where passion and perseverance were the real machinery behind every creation.

In this session, Altaf Gul Muhammad from Yunus Textile Mills shares his unique perspective on the rapid transformation of the textile industry, especially following the COVID-19 pandemic. Reflecting on the period of 2017–18, he recalls a time when most operations were carried out manually, with in-person inspections and traditional reporting systems.

However, the pandemic accelerated the adoption of digital technologies, making online tools essential for day-to-day operations. Altaf explains how even tasks that once required physical presence such as quality inspections, monitoring production, and sharing reports with clients—have shifted to digital platforms. With cameras for remote supervision, digital inspection methods, and instant online reporting, the industry has seen unprecedented efficiency and transparency.

He also highlights the broader implications of this technological takeover: reduced dependency on manual labor, faster decision-making, and enhanced customer engagement.
